Young Artists Competition Print E-mail

The Idaho Falls Symphony’s Young Artists Competition is usually held every other year, and is intended to encourage and reward promising young musical talent in the state of Idaho. It also provides a venue in which young artists can “get a taste” of competition beyond their immediate locale, which will also serve them well as they progress in their musical careers. The current personnel of the Idaho Falls Symphony boasts members who are previous winners of the competition.

The winner of the competition is featured as the guest artist for one of the orchestra’s subscription series concerts. Contestants must be residents of Idaho or students in Idaho universities or colleges and no older than twenty-four at the time of the competition, which is usually held in September. A call for applications is generally announced every other spring. Judges for the competition are distinguished teachers and performers from outside the state of Idaho.

Previous Young Artists’ Competition Winners



kristina-willeyKristina Willey, Viola – 2008 Winner


Kristina began music lessons at 18 months, on a 32nd size violin/viola; she now studies viola with Dr. Kevin Call at BYU-Idaho on full music scholarships as a Music Major with an emphasis in Viola Performance; former teachers include Dr. David Dalton, Dr. Claudine Bigelow, and Dr. Irene Peery-Fox on piano. A native of Pleasant Grove, Utah, she has won first prize three times in the Utah State Fair, soloed with the Utah Symphony in 2003, and was featured on the national radio program "From the Top" in April 2005. Kristina is a missionary in the Orchestra at Temple Square, was twice principal violist of Utah's All-State Orchestra and Annenberg Debut Symphony in Malibu. She was Utah's Emersen Scholarship winner at Interlochen Arts Camp in 2004. She also participated for 2 years in the Disney Young Musicians' Symphony Orchestra, in the National High School Honors Orchestra, and won the Utah Symphony Youth Guild Competition three times. Kristina is a trained Suzuki violin/viola teacher, and enjoys teaching her students, ages 4-12. Kristina also enjoys drawing, reading, and writing. Kristina performed the Walton Viola Concerto with the Idaho Falls Symphony on February 28, 2009.
